Abstract

Based on data obtained from the Ministry of Indonesia Health in 2012, Diabetes mellitus (DM) was ranked as the sixth leading cause of death. In a higher phase, it can cause complications in other organs such in retina. A disease that attacks the retina is Diabetic Retinopathy (DR). Although it is not a deadly disease, but patient can suffer permanent blindness, which can affect mental and social condition. Therefore built a system that can detect early. So the initial inspection can be faster. This Research uses data from Dr. Cipto Mangunkusumo Hospital (RSCM) Jakarta, Indonesia and DiaretDB0 as comparative data. This research uses knowledge, Fast Adaptive Histogram Equalization as pre-processing method, and Extreme Learning Machine as classification methods from previous research. Feature used is the area of blood vessels. In the previous research, DiaretDB0 reached 97,5%. After that we use these knowledge for RSCM data. But in the experiment, it reached only 52% for testing accuracy, lower than DiaretDB0. The contribution from this research is analysis why the result from both data is different and suggestion for the next research.
